Dr. Ettinger’s research focuses on the effects of environmental exposures on reproductive, perinatal, and children's health. The objective of her work is to understand how common genetic variants and dietary nutrients may modify susceptibility to environmental exposures in the maternal-fetal unit and, ultimately, impact toxicant-induced pregnancy and developmental outcomes.
